hsfl.net
当前位置:首页 >> JAvAwEB jquEry中 AjAx 请求回来的值都是String类... >>

JAvAwEB jquEry中 AjAx 请求回来的值都是String类...

首先,ajax回来的肯定是string 。 其次,一般是约定为json字符串的格式进行传输,js接收到jsonstring格式的数据后,使用 JSON.parse(data)转换为json对象,之后按照正常处理就可以了。 $.ajax({ url:"..", data:"parameters", success:function(...

Object类型的,在js中也是可以直接使用XX.name方式获龋数组类型的,直接迭代,

$.ajax({ type : function(jsonStr) { alert(jsonStr), dataType ;json", success : '.jsp”, url:http://www.baidu.com; } }) 这个回调函数中的参数 jsonStr是json格式的,请求后服务器端返回的数据会根据这个值解析后;,以执行回调函数,所以返...

Java中返回的值通常由3中,JSON,文本,XML 如果你用的Struts框架,那么我的使用方式是,JQuery用Ajax请求Struts层后,Struts获取response.getWriter()后用.print()方法输出你要返回的数据,然后不再用return mapping.forward.....而用 return null 这...

在响应页,直接用echo 就可以得到string类型的了。

ajax原理你弄错了! if(Daofactry,getITAdminDao.findLogin(adminVo)) { JSONObject object=new JSONObject(); object.put("su", "xxxxx"); object.put("ff", "xxxxx"); response.getWriter().write(object.toString()); } js修改: success:reS...

dataType 类型:String 预期服务器返回的数据类型。如果不指定,jQuery 将自动根据 HTTP 包 MIME 信息来智能判断,比如 XML MIME 类型就被识别为 XML。在 1.4 中,JSON 就会生成一个 JavaScript 对象,而 script 则会执行这个脚本。随后服务器端...

$.ajax({ type: 'get', //ajax的方式 get/post cache: false, //是否缓存 dataType: 'json', //接收返回数据的方式 url: "?"+stype, //路径 timeout: 3000, //超时时间 success:function(data){ //成功后返回的回调方法 var json // data就是后...

1、$.ajax默认使用异步也就是async:true的方式调用ajax请求数据。这种方式会在ajax回调完成之前执行后面的代码,如果你要等ajax回调完成后再执行后面的代码,可以设置成async:false。 2、$.ajax()操作完成后,如果使用的是低于1.5.0版本的jQue...

解决方法是关闭response的writer。 下面是ajax代码 $j.ajax({type : "POST",url : "/asi/jsonCarrier.jsp",data : {"artistId":"${artistID}"}, //这里从session里拿出了artistID变量,用的是el表达式datatype : "text",timeout: 10000,success ...

网站首页 | 网站地图
All rights reserved Powered by www.hsfl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com